You can do the installation without removing the frunk but it is much easier to do without the frunk in place. Some will remove the bottom bolts and prop the frunk a little out of the way. I removed it to allow access to the zerk (grease) fittings and do a lube job as well. I do have some pictures in my albums but not much to go on.
